fix(jsonl): reject unusable roots at plugin load

A configured root that already exists as a file or unreadable directory cannot host cwd buckets, but the backend previously mounted and deferred that deterministic configuration error until a later list or write.

Probe the resolved root while the plugin loads, surface every error except ENOENT, and keep an absent root valid for lazy first materialization. Document the timing contract, regenerate the config catalog, and pin the non-directory case at the load boundary.

/** Require an existing configured root to be a readable directory. */
private assertUsableRoot(): void {
try {
readdirSync(this.root)
} catch (error) {
if (isENOENT(error)) return
throw error
}
}
